|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 445 人关注过本帖
标题:求这一道编程题怎样解释? 有重赏!
只看楼主 加入收藏
飘逸由在
该用户已被删除
收藏
已结贴  问题点数:20 回复次数:3 
求这一道编程题怎样解释? 有重赏!
提示: 作者被禁止或删除 内容自动屏蔽
搜索更多相关主题的帖子: 重赏 解释 
2010-05-14 16:53
xueyuhanhai
Rank: 4
等 级:业余侠客
帖 子:90
专家分:238
注 册:2010-4-5
收藏
得分:10 
#include "stdafx.h"

int main(int argc, char* argv[])
{
    char ch[2][5]={"6937","8254"},*p[2];//ch是一个二维的数组,p是指针数组,即里面放了两个指针;
    int i,j,s=0;
    for(i=0;i<2;i++)
        p[i]=ch[i];//ch[i]是地址,是每一行的首地址;这一行的意思是把每一行的首地址给p[i],即使p指向对应行。
    for(i=0;i<2;i++)
    for(j=0;p[i][j]>'\0';j+=2)//在每一列上,隔一个数取值
        s=10*s+p[i][j]-'0';//对取下的字符型的数据做操作,系统会自动的把字符型的转换为相应的ASC码,即整数进行运算的。
       printf("%d\n",s); 
    printf("\n");
    printf("Hello World!\n");
    return 0;
}
我用的是VC++6.0编译的,但是编译报错,
--------------------Configuration: sdftgr - Win32 Debug--------------------
Compiling...
sdftgr.cpp
C:\Program Files\Microsoft Visual Studio\MyProjects\sdftgr\sdftgr.cpp(16) : error C2018: unknown character '0xa1'
C:\Program Files\Microsoft Visual Studio\MyProjects\sdftgr\sdftgr.cpp(16) : error C2018: unknown character '0xa1'
Error executing cl.exe.
大家帮忙啊。我的理解有错吗?找一下代码的错误啊。
2010-05-14 18:21
tfxanxing
Rank: 3Rank: 3
等 级:论坛游侠
威 望:2
帖 子:82
专家分:165
注 册:2010-5-7
收藏
得分:10 

楼上的没什么问题啊,就是头文件包含你写的是啥?
我稍做了修改 ,可以运行的,结果是6385嘛,大家指点啊...

#include <iostream>

using namespace std;                    //我用的是vs2008,c++
int main(int argc, char* argv[])
{
    char ch[2][5]={"6937","8254"},*p[2];//ch是一个二维的数组,p是指针数组,即里面放了两个指针;
    int i,j,s=0;
    for(i=0;i<2;i++)
        p[i]=ch[i];//ch[i]是地址,是每一行的首地址;这一行的意思是把每一行的首地址给p[i],即使p指向对应行。
    for(i=0;i<2;i++)
    for(j=0;p[i][j]>'\0';j+=2)//在每一列上,隔一个数取值
        s=10*s+p[i][j]-'0';//对取下的字符型的数据做操作,系统会自动的把字符型的转换为相应的ASC码,即整数进行运算的。
    cout<<s<<endl;        //c++的输出
    printf("%d",s);
    printf("\n");
    printf("Hello World!\n");
    return 0;
}
2010-05-14 18:50
tfxanxing
Rank: 3Rank: 3
等 级:论坛游侠
威 望:2
帖 子:82
专家分:165
注 册:2010-5-7
收藏
得分:0 
楼主的头文件都没包含,main函数也没限定类型(void main())
2010-05-14 18:53
快速回复:求这一道编程题怎样解释? 有重赏!
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.033976 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ved